Citi Trends Inc. Form 8-K Summary
Business Context and Reporting Period
This Current Report on Form 8-K was filed by Citi Trends Inc. on May 26, 2010, regarding the company's annual meeting of stockholders held on that date. The filing details the outcomes of shareholder votes on director elections and the ratification of the independent auditor.

Key Facts for Investor Verification
- Director Re-election: All nominated directors were re-elected for a three-year term until 2013.
- Voting Results: Brian P. Carney received 13,310,395 votes for; John S. Lupo received 13,310,895 votes for.
- Auditor Ratification: Shareholders ratified the appointment of KPMG LLP as the independent registered public accounting firm for fiscal 2010 with 13,460,215 votes for.
- Broker Non-Votes: There were 324,948 broker non-votes for the director elections, but zero broker non-votes for the auditor ratification.
